Rural Wisdom Evaluation - The value of connection in light of COVID-19

“Rural Wisdom, as we knew it, had been stopped in its tracks” (Staff member Volunteering Matters)

Rural wisdom image Jan 20

This short report shares the experiences and reflections of the Volunteering Matters Cymru team leading the Rural Wisdom project in Wales on the impact the COVID-19 Pandemic has had upon their work. In sharing these reflections, the report aims to provide others living and working in rural areas to apply and benefit from what works, in fast-paced and challenging times.
